What happens when a childhood cancer survivor, a Romance Languages major, and a champion for teens grows up to become one of the most dedicated District Court Judges in Moore and Hoke Counties? You get Judge Beth Tanner — a woman whose story is as compelling as her commitment to justice.
In this heartfelt and eye-opening episode, host Rose Young sits down with Judge Tanner for a conversation that moves from deeply human to unexpectedly funny, offering listeners a rare look behind the robe.
You’ll hear about: ✨ The surprising path that led her from literature to law ✨ How surviving cancer shaped her compassion and resilience ✨ Why she invests so fiercely in teenagers through Teen Court, debate, and mock trial ✨ What District Court really handles and why it impacts all of us ✨ Practical wisdom for small-business owners ✨ The heart and philosophy that guide her decisions on the bench ✨ And yes — the Victorian home with gavels carved into the staircase
